The Edge Banding Machine: The Workhorse of Furniture Production
An edge banding machine is the powerhouse that applies the edge banding to the furniture. Its quality directly impacts the final product's appearance, durability, and longevity. Choosing the right machine is crucial for efficiency and effectiveness. There are several types of edge banding machines available, each with its own capabilities and price point:
Manual Edge Banders: These are the most basic and affordable option, suitable for small-scale workshops or hobbyists. They are hand-fed, making the process slower and potentially less consistent.
Semi-Automatic Edge Banders: These machines offer a degree of automation, typically handling feeding and trimming. They increase efficiency compared to manual machines and provide better consistency.
Automatic Edge Banders: These are the workhorses of large-scale furniture manufacturing. They automate nearly every aspect of the process, from feeding and applying the banding to trimming and finishing. They offer high speed, precision, and significant productivity gains.
The capabilities of an edge banding machine extend beyond simply gluing the strip. Advanced models often incorporate features like:
Pre-milling: This prepares the edge for perfect adhesion.
Glue application: Precise and consistent glue application is essential for a strong bond.
Edge banding application: Accurate placement of the banding is crucial for a clean finish.
Trimming: Precise trimming removes excess banding for a seamless look.
Scraping and buffing: These finishing touches create a smooth, professional finish.
Profiling and Radiusing: Some machines can create rounded or shaped edges.
Investing in a good edge banding machine means investing in quality and efficiency. However, even the best machine is useless without the right edge banding.
Edge Banding: The Finishing Touch
Edge banding itself is the material applied to the edges of furniture components. Its choice significantly impacts the final product's aesthetics, durability, and feel. Various materials are available, each with its pros and cons:
PVC Edge Banding: This is a popular and cost-effective option, offering excellent durability and resistance to scratches and moisture. It comes in a vast range of colors and finishes.
Melamine Edge Banding: This is a budget-friendly choice, often matching the surface material of the furniture. It's relatively easy to work with but can be less durable than PVC.
ABS Edge Banding: This offers superior durability and resistance to chemicals and impacts compared to PVC and melamine. It's a great choice for high-end furniture.
Wood Edge Banding: This provides a natural and luxurious look, enhancing the overall aesthetic appeal. However, it's more expensive and requires more precise application.
Acrylic Edge Banding: This offers a modern and sleek appearance, with high gloss and durability. It's a good choice for contemporary furniture designs.
Beyond the material itself, the thickness and quality of the edge banding are crucial factors. Thicker banding offers better durability, while higher-quality banding ensures a smoother, more consistent finish. The color and texture should also complement the overall design of the furniture.
